From eebe8dbd8630f51cf70b1f68a440cd3d7f7a914d Mon Sep 17 00:00:00 2001 From: Yicong Yang Date: Wed, 21 Jan 2026 18:15:43 +0800 Subject: [PATCH] coresight: tmc: Decouple the perf buffer allocation from sysfs mode Currently the perf buffer allocation follows the below logic: - if the required AUX buffer size if larger, allocate the buffer with the required size - otherwise allocate the size reference to the sysfs buffer size This is not useful as we only collect to one AUX data, so just try to allocate the buffer match the AUX buffer size.
